Flash memory refers to a particular type of EEPROM, or Electronically Erasable Programmable Read Only Memory. It is a memory chip that maintains stored information without requiring a power source.

Flash memory differs from EEPROM in that EEPROM erases its content one byte at a time. This makes it slow to update. Flash memory can erase its data in entire blocks, making it a preferable technology for applications that require frequent updating of large amounts of data as in the case of a memory stick.

Inside the flash chip, information is stored in cells. A floating gate protects the data written in each cell. Tunneling electrons pass through a low conductive material to change the electronic charge of the gate in "a flash," clearing the cell of its contents so that it can be rewritten. This is how flash memory gets its name.

Flash memory utilizes direct tunneling in NAND type flash memory and hot electron in NOR type flash memory. To do this flash memory cells require high voltages. The required voltage level in NAND type is higher than in NOR type because NAND type utilizes direct tunneling. This kind of stress degrade the dielectric quality in flash memory. (Even in just COMS logic gate the switching degrade the dielectric quality) After a number of read/write cycles, when large amount of carriers are trapped in dielectric or some defects grow up, the memory cell can not guarantee the correct data due to the Vt change or leakage, which is the life of flash memory.

In spec, NAND type allow 1 or 2bit error but NOR type doesn't. So NAND type memory uses ECC (error correction code) to recover the bit error.

It is possible to have some bad sectors but they should be controlled by controller (like hard disk).
